Michael Mercier overtakes Rick Woulfe for lead at Dixie Senior Amateur

Michael Mercier of June Beach, Fla. posted a 68 on Saturday at Heron Bay to overtake first-roiund leader Rick Woulfe

FT. LAUDERDALE, Florida (December 13, 2014) - - Rick Woulfe's torrid streak of golf came to and end on Saturday, but heck, he might be tired. That would be understandable after winning both the Crane Cup and Society of Seniors Ralph Bogart tournaments (the latter only finishing on Wednesday) and then going out and shooting 6-under in the first round of the Dixie. Who does he think he is, Jordan Spieth?

All kidding aside, Woulfe, a living legend of Florida amateur golf and lifetime member of AmateuGolf.com, hardly shot himself in the foot on Saturday, posting 1- over 73 to stand at 5-under and one shot back of new leader Michael Mercier. He will of course, be playing in the final group on Sunday.

And let's give Mercier some credit for going out and taking things into his own hands. The June Beach, Florida resident's 4-under 68 is one of the best in the tournament and by far the best on Sunday, when no other player broke 70. (5 players shot under 70 on Friday.) If Mercier can shave two strokes off of that as he did off his first round 70, he's going to be tough to beat on Sunday. Earlier this year, he tackled challenging conditions in finishing third at the British Senior Amateur.

Rounding out the final group at Heron Bay on Sunday is defending champ Doug Hanzel, the 2013 U.S. Senior champion who stands at 3-under after an even-par 72 on Saturday.

SUPER SENIOR
Stepen Rose and Craig Scott are tied for the Super-Senior lead at one-under 143 while John Baldwin is three back.

About the Dixie Senior & Mid-Master

The senior version of the Dixie Amateur Championship added a Mid-Master division starting in 2019. 54-hole stroke play event with no cut. Mid-Master (ages 40- 54), Senior (ages 55-64) and Super Senior (65+) Divisions. The tournament has long drawn so...
